Output b91c84b5dd85e148ebff44ced78702c8b1710d209a982ff6f177ecb52ff61143:12

value
21156956
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08722364245e56980ede2d2bccfde8d8c2d499ea9e8fefd25226900960874317
address
bc1pppezxepytetfsrk7954uel0gmrpdfx02n687l5jjy6gqjcy8gvtssyka5w
transaction
b91c84b5dd85e148ebff44ced78702c8b1710d209a982ff6f177ecb52ff61143
confirmations
123506
spent
true